I supplied a very solid bare shell for deseaming (all of them inc bumpers and roof) and returning in primer to a very good body shop, but also a very good friend, next door to the unit where I work on cars. Price to me was £1000 xmas cash special including fitting the fibreglass front end, roof, fitting gapping/prepping doors/boot. Now he's done it, and I have to say to a very high standard, he says it would be at least £1500 for anyone else! And thats just deseaming the shell and returning in primer. It can be done cheaply by cutting corners, but for a proper job its a getting on for a weeks work for a pro.

i bought a deseamed mini few years ago, few cracks in the filler so decided to scrape the old filler off and refresh it, soon as i took the filler off there was a big problem... the seams wernt welded at all! just cut off and a small layer of fibreglass bridge stuck to the rear of the seam then filler at the front to smooth it over! didnt last long though, i stripped it and sold the shell to a banger racer! didnt fancy runnin a car that would spring open in a tiny knock!
